What to Expect from a Restoration Visit in Highland

Understanding the restoration process reduces stress during an already difficult situation. When technicians arrive at your Highland property, they begin with a comprehensive damage assessment using moisture meters and thermal imaging. This inspection identifies the water category—clean, gray, or black—which determines safety protocols and cleaning requirements.

Water extraction follows immediately, using powerful submersible pumps and truck-mounted vacuum systems to remove standing water. For Highland properties with finished basements or crawl spaces common in the area, technicians pay special attention to subfloor moisture that can warp hardwood and compromise structural supports.

The drying phase typically spans three to five days, though severe flooding may extend this timeline. Technicians strategically place air movers and dehumidifiers, monitoring progress daily and adjusting equipment placement. Throughout Madison County, restoration teams must account for Highland's variable humidity and seasonal temperature swings that affect evaporation rates.

Final restoration includes antimicrobial application, odor treatment, and reconstruction of damaged materials. Quality providers return your property to pre-loss condition, coordinating repairs to drywall, flooring, and cabinetry so you don't manage multiple contractors.

Frequently Asked Questions

How quickly should I call for water damage restoration in Highland?

Contact restoration professionals immediately—ideally within the first hour. Water spreads rapidly through porous materials, and mold can begin developing within 24 to 48 hours in Highland's humid climate. Faster response significantly reduces repair costs and prevents permanent damage to flooring, drywall, and personal belongings.

Will my insurance cover water damage restoration in Madison County?

Most homeowner policies cover sudden and accidental water damage from sources like burst pipes or appliance failures. However, coverage varies for flooding from external sources, which typically requires separate flood insurance. Reputable Highland restoration companies work directly with insurers, documenting damage thoroughly and assisting with claims paperwork to streamline your reimbursement.

How long does complete water damage restoration take in Highland?

Timeline depends on damage severity and affected materials. Minor incidents may resolve in three to four days. Extensive flooding requiring reconstruction can extend to several weeks.
